At Another we are currently supporting a well establish, commercial fast paced client in their search for a Head of HR.  Working as a small team, reporting into the CEO and an integral part of the leadership team you will be pivotal in being strategic and operational as a HR partner in building a high-performance culture.

The Role

  • Translate business strategy into a clear people plan with measurable goals
  • Lead workforce planning with Heads of Function to anticipate short and long-term resourcing needs
  • Report regularly to the Board and SLT on people performance, risks, and recommendations
  • First point of contact for all people matters — ER, performance, absence, grievance, and disciplinary
  • Keep all HR documentation, handbooks, and policies compliant and current
  • Support the business through organisational change including restructures, M&A, and TUPE
  • Own and maintain the HRIS, ensuring data is accurate and drives better decisions
  • Lead end-to-end recruitment and onboarding across the business
  • Build employer brand with Marketing, including EVP and careers pages
  • Build and maintain a skills and progression framework with clear development plans and career pathways
  • Coach line managers on training needs and development budgets
  • Drive a culture of openness, belonging, and high performance across all teams
  • Champion AI adoption across the business, leading by example and implementing tools that create efficiencies
  • Work with Heads of Function to understand how AI is reshaping roles and factor this into workforce planning
  • Build confidence and curiosity around AI, ensuring people can identify and implement improvements across the full people lifecycle

Skills

  • CIPD Level 7 qualified or above, or equivalent
  • Proven experience as a strong HR generalist professional with strategic and operational experience.
  • Excellent working knowledge of UK employment law and having experience of managing complex cases.
  • Strong use and curiosity of AI tools, with experience of developing or contributing to an AI-ready workforce
  • Track record of leading recruitment end to end, including employer brand and candidate experience.
  • Confident using people data to produce clear reports and make evidence-based recommendations.
  • Experience supporting businesses through organisational change, including restructures, acquisitions, mergers and TUPE.
  • Strong communicator who builds trust quickly at all levels.
  • Experience of leading, coaching and mentoring teams
